What you will study

Those who are passionate about animal welfare, health and behaviour, this course will provide them with a gateway to life-long learning about issues that will really matter to the shared future.

Students will have the opportunity to take advantage of industrial collaborations with specialist research-based companies, including animal breeding and research companies, through the Industry Liaison Lab at Discovery Park, Sandwich.

This course is accredited by the Royal Society of Biology for the purpose of meeting in part the academic and experience requirement for the Membership and Chartered Biologist (CBiol).

Animal-based enterprises operate in a tightly regulated environment and require well trained, knowledgeable professionals with knowledge of animal welfare, health, and behaviour.

Changes in animal welfare laws in Britain have meant that there is now more control and regulation of all animal-based enterprises. This has resulted in a greater need for a scientific approach to animal management and welfare across all businesses that work with animals. These sectors require well-prepared animal scientists who can apply their knowledge to emerging management issues.

On the course students will develop a detailed knowledge of animal husbandry, genetics, molecular biology, and biochemical and physiological processes, and have opportunities to interact and work with a range of employers in the field. Students will also be able to take advantage of their Life Sciences Industry Liaison Lab at Discovery Park.
